Location: Montreal EastJob Summary You will be part of a team that spans across all business domains. You will provide advanced analytical insights using data analysis and machine learning techniques. You will collaborate with teams across the company, exploring various data sources to help identify new opportunities while driving the adoption of AI. As an expert data scientist, you will combine your knowledge of machine learning and software development skills to automate model development, training, and deployment.
You will leverage your experience in building reusable algorithms, functions, and libraries to use in model development for predictive and prescriptive analytics.
